What is Foreclosure?
Foreclosure refers to a legal procedure enabling a lender to recover the balance of a loan when a borrower fails to meet their repayment obligations. This often requires selling the mortgaged property to settle the outstanding debt. Laws and procedures vary by state, but the process often begins after a series of missed payments when the lender issues a notice of default.

Should the homeowner fail to resolve the default, the real estate may be auctioned or sold directly. In many cases, the lender must follow strict legal guidelines to ensure the individual is properly notified and given opportunities to address the situation before the foreclosure process is finalized. These steps are critical in protecting the rights of all parties involved.

Legal Expertise in Foreclosure Cases
Foreclosure case management is governed by complex legal requirements, where even a small oversight can lead to serious consequences. More so, laws vary by state and often involve strict timelines, detailed documentation, and precise methods for serving legal notices. A process service expert understands all the nuances, complies with court-specific rules, and delivers every document on time. They know how to solve challenges like tracking down uncooperative defendants, managing cases with multiple parties, and adhering to court-ordered procedures.

Speed and Efficiency
Legal cases often operate within strict timelines, where every step must be handled promptly. The average process in the US can take anywhere from 180 to 200 days, depending on the state and the type of foreclosure service, but missing key deadlines can extend this timeframe significantly. Specialists are familiar with official standards and serve documents in accordance with the prescribed rules, keeping the process moving forward.
